  • International Price of Crude Oil - Indian Basket Inches up on 19.3.2012

  • The international crude oil prices for Indian Basket as computed/published today by the Petroleum Planning and Analysis Cell (PPAC) under the Ministry of Petroleum and Natural Gas increased to    US$ 124.64 per barrel (bbl). The price, computed and published by PPAC on their website is based on last trading day’s figures of 19.03.2012. The price previously computed/ published on 19.3.2012 based on trading figures of 16.3.2012, was US$ 123.35 per bbl.

  • In rupee terms also, the crude oil price was higher today at Rs 6246.96   against Rs 6205.74   per bbl published on 19.3.2012, due to higher crude oil price in dollar terms, despite rupee appreciation with rupee/dollar exchange rate at  Rs 50.12   /US$ on 19.03.2012 against Rs 50.31   /US$ on  16.3.2012.
